Chapter 621A – G.o.d Skeleton


Night.


You Qi looked at the deeply slumbering Qin Yu. Her fingers were twined together with his. She gazed upon his wrinkled eyebrows, not daring to close her eyes.


The devil mark’s backlash had erupted. She could clearly feel two consciousnesses fighting within Qin Yu.


After an unknown length of time, Qin Yu’s tense body gradually relaxed. You Qi finally let out a deep breath and only then did she discover that her clothes were drenched in sweat.


A wave of weariness rushed over her. After a careful inspection to ensure that Qin Yu was fine, she fell asleep in several breaths of time.


These short several hours were no different from a round of brutal torture for Qin Yu. She had watched on, completely helpless as Qin Yu struggled to survive.


When Qin Yu woke up, the first thing he saw was her thin and pallid face. Ever since she realized his situation, she hadn’t relaxed for even a single moment.


A feeling of guilt rose up in the depths of his heart. When he looked at this woman in front of him, he had no idea what he had to do in order to repay her.


In an absent-minded daze, You Qi’s eyelashes fluttered and she slowly opened her eyes. As their gazes met, a brilliant smile broke free on her face.


Qin Yu couldn’t help but acknowledge that he was moved by this smile. After hesitating for a moment he held onto her hand and said, “You Qi, thank you.”


Looking at her hand that was being held by Qin Yu, You Qi’s smile brightened. She squeezed back tightly, telling herself that since she caught hold of him today, she would never let him go.



At almost the same time, on an island off the distant end of Great Chu, Old Ghost opened his eyes, his face pale. He was able to confirm that Speechless’s aura had disappeared!


He was well aware of what this meant. After a long period of silence he was unable to suppress the roiling feelings in his chest. He clenched his teeth and roared out, “b.a.s.t.a.r.d!”


He stood up. With a flick of his sleeves a wild strength erupted, crus.h.i.+ng everything around him and erasing all traces of himself.


Old Ghost shot into the skies. s.p.a.ce fiercely twisted and swallowed up his body.


No one knew that a long time ago, after a certain event, Speechless had already become a back road he had prepared for himself.


But now, this back road had been blocked…and if this person could kill Speechless, then killing him wouldn’t be hard either. Thus, he wasn’t full of anger and craving revenge. Rather, he felt panic and uneasiness as he fled to the west.


He wanted to flee, flee to the endless sea of the west…who knew whether that useless trash Speechless had exposed his position!



The Chu Empire occupied a vast territory supported by boundless lands. To the far west was the boundless sea. Here, islands were spread out like stars in the skies. Somewhere in these waters, several islands were connected to each other, their shape resembling a carp. Because of it, this collection of islands was referred to as Carp Archipelago.


Within the archipelago, around where the eye of the carp should be, there was an island that was several miles in size. But, what was astounding was that there were actually tall mountains covering this small island. Dozens of mountains were piled together, desperately towering into the skies. After seeing this, one couldn’t help but feel worried that this little island would eventually topple over.


Beneath the mountain range there were valleys filled with ancient trees and vines. Old Ghost tightly furrowed his eyebrows together. He looked down at several terrifyingly large holes that extended down as far as the eye could see.


A stone pillar drilled out, shooting straight into the heavens. Its rough surface was covered with traces of erosion. It had clearly existed for a long, long time.


But between the blurry marks atop the stone pillar, traces of blood quietly extended upwards. They drilled all the way to the top of the stone pillar where a skeleton was sitting cross-legged, weaving together ‘bloodlines’ on its white bones.


Because of the existence of these ‘bloodlines’, the skeleton gave off a feeling that it was still alive. As if countless years ago, it had been exposed here in the world, doomed to suffer the onslaught of endless wind and rain.


“There is less and less G.o.d blood…” Old Ghost muttered to himself. There was a cold chill in his eyes as well as an inconcealable fear somewhere even deeper within.


Speechless had been killed and the G.o.d blood was continuously decreasing. Old Ghost could feel the smell of death rus.h.i.+ng towards his direction once again and it left him feeling breathless.


He turned around left. Soon, the indigenous people living atop the archipelago received a message from their Lord Priest. The evil G.o.d was about to escape. If the tribe wished to ensure the continuation of their people and inheritance then they would need to begin a large-scale sacrifice and offer the power of flesh and blood to suppress the evil G.o.d.


Throughout the various great tribes of the archipelago, the sounds of happy talk and laughter soon disappeared. Those that had the qualifications to be sacrificed were all young men and women. They hugged their children and knelt in front of their parents. After deeply bowing, they strode towards their doom, their grief-filled faces full of firm resolve.


This was an unavoidable matter that had repeated itself since ancient times. But, as long as their parents and children were able to continue living on, they did not fear death.


Lines of indigenous men and women were led to the stone pillar by the priests. After bowing and praying, they leapt in. The giant hole in the ground was like the open maw of a giant beast. It swallowed them up, leaving no trace behind.


Old Ghost coldly watched all of this occur. Although this ‘raising’ function was becoming increasingly less useful, it was all he could do right now. If he had been able to kill the Demon Sovereign outside of Thistle Capital, he wouldn’t have been placed in such a desperate situation.


“d.a.m.n it!”


Old Ghost cursed and walked away. This ‘raising’ would require a period of time. He couldn’t delay here any longer.


Living was a wonderful miracle that one should be thankful for. He had to value and utilize every second of time available to him, not wasting even the briefest moment.


Two months later, the ‘raising’ finally came to an end. At the expense of millions upon millions of native lives, the decreasing trend of the G.o.d blood finally stabilized.


Old Ghost let out a deep breath but he didn’t truly feel relaxed. He knew that this sort of ‘stable’ condition wouldn’t last for too long.


The island natives wouldn’t be able to carry out a second sacrificial ceremony for at least another hundred years. During this period of time he needed to find some other method to enhance the production of G.o.d blood.


Half a year had pa.s.sed since Speechless died. Everything had been calm and quiet so far. He thought that he might have been overly wary; perhaps it was time to return to the Land of Divinity and Demons.


In the vast and endless sea, all one could see was water all around. A man and woman walked over the waves. Wherever they pa.s.sed, the surface of the sea would instantly quiet down, as if it were the flat surface of a mirror.


You Qi pulled on Qin Yu’s arm, a puzzled expression on her face. “My Demonic Path’s influence is spread throughout the world but we still haven’t been able to find any traces of Old Ghost’s whereabouts. How did Your Majesty know he was hiding here?”


Qin Yu smiled. “It was the news given to me by the G.o.d Hunters.”


You Qi furrowed her eyebrows together. “G.o.d Hunters? What influence is this? How come I’ve never heard of them before?”


Qin Yu explained, “To be exact, the G.o.d Hunters isn’t a true organization. Rather, it is a union formed by numerous rogue cultivators. It’s just that the threshold to join is extremely high. They purchase and sell information, as well as perform other services like a.s.sa.s.sinations.”


You Qi wrinkled her nose. “Is Your Majesty saying that I don’t have the qualifications to learn about the G.o.d Hunters right now?”


Qin Yu helplessly shook his head. “It’s not like that.” He and You Qi were extremely discreet in their movements; even the Demonic Path didn’t know their whereabouts. But, they had still been found by the G.o.d Hunters. At least in terms of intelligence gathering, there weren’t many other organizations that could match them.


Information about Old Ghost’s location was given to him by the G.o.d Hunters on their own initiative because they desired to create a favorable impression. Although they were known as the G.o.d Hunters, able to perform any service and kill any person, there were still certain limits. For instance, the Demonic Path’s Holy Monarch.


The status represented by this t.i.tle was something that the G.o.d Hunters dared not touch. Of course, another possibility was that no one could pay the price to hunt down the Holy Monarch.


On the horizon where the sea and sky met, a mountain range suddenly appeared. The closer they approached, the more mountains appeared. Finally they could see several islands connected together.


You Qi pursed her lips. She softly asked, “It’s here?”


Qin Yu nodded. He turned and traced her hair, smiling as he said, “Don’t worry. Just wait here for me to return.”


With a flick of his sleeves, seawater automatically rose up. It formed a water bubble that wrapped around You Qi.


Pa –


The water bubble fell into the sea and vanished from sight.


Qin Yu took a deep breath and walked towards the archipelago. Faint traces of an invisible aura spread out from his body. It resonated with the heavens and earth, touching the rule lines.


As a result, winds began to rise within the world. Although there were no clouds in the skies, it began to darken as if the light itself was disappearing.


The invisible aura spread over the entire archipelago. The monster beasts racing through the mountain forests started to howl and sob, falling to the ground and s.h.i.+vering. The priests amongst the tribes who stepped upon the road of cultivation all stared with wide eyes as their complexions paled.
